Harry Winstone sets new world record for the diamond
Harry Winston, diamond production and distribution company, has set the new record price ever paid for diamond during Christies auction in Switzerland, Geneva.
Jewelry company, Harry Winston, who also own mines as well as other facilities to produce diamonds, on Wednesday night in Christies auction, Geneva Switzerland, has bought for $ 26,7 million for the 101,73 carat diamond.
According to Christies representative Raul Kadakia, Harry Winston, as well known as Dominion Diamond Corp., bought this particular diamond. I th process of purchasing this precious stone Harry Winston has beaten previous world record by $ 10 million.
Diamond itslef is 101,73 carat was found in Jwaneng mine, locaten in Kalahari desert, Botswana. Raw diamond was 236 carat but after carefull processing it has slimmed down to 101,73 carats.
As the first buyer Harry Winstone were awarded with privilage to name the stone. It was called – Harry Legacy. The diamond was given D colour (the highest grade the stone can get) and was identified as flawless. Another feature cotributing to this diamonds value was it’s correct asymmentric shape. Christies experts were expecting to the price to go up to $ 30 million.
Canadian company Harry Winston has sold it’s high-end jewelry department to Swiss watch maker Swatch for $ 1 billion in 2012.
